Reporting to

The Project Communicator position will coordinate programmatically with the Project Manager; will respond institutionally to the AVSI representative in Peru and the LATAM General Coordinator

Aim of the position:

The objective of this TDR is to hire the figure of Project Communicator, based in the city of Lima (Peru), who will be responsible for leading the project communication component “Towards a future with equality, with better protection systems universal social and labor inclusion”, according to the internal guidelines of the financier and AVSI.

Main tasks and responsibilities:

The functions of the Project Communicator position include, but are not limited to:
• Develop the Project communication strategy, in direct coordination with the AVSI Project Manager and the IILA Program Director, making the corresponding adjustments accordingly. to its progress;
• Design and execute the communication actions that are necessary to achieve the Project objectives, based on the existing communication strategy;
• Design and manage the graphic identity of the Project, according to institutional guidelines;
• Design strategies that allow generating or strengthening relationships with different actors that enhance the communication impact of the Project;
• Develop inter-institutional coordination and help generate strategic alliances in communication matters to achieve the goals and objectives of the Project;
• Design, coordinate and execute communication campaigns (virtual and in-person) in coordination with the Project team and the Communications area of ​​AVSI HQ and IILA;
• Be responsible for the design, production, printing, management and others of all communication materials and knowledge generation in the Project;
• Collaborate with the organization and execution of events, especially in the design of materials, communication pieces and all related communication activities;
• Ensure coverage of events relevant to the Project and AVSI;
• Carry out media dissemination activities of the main activities carried out by the Project, through the production of press releases, news, executive summaries, graphic and audiovisual production, and others;
• As needed, design and manage institutional and Project social networks;
• Monitor the scope/impact of the various Project activities on different channels (web platforms, media, social networks, etc.);
• Participate in the preparation of the communication section of the reports, according to institutional requirements;
• Present reports and means of verification of the activities under your responsibility;
• Provide assistance to the Project and AVSI team in specific communication demands;
• Carry out other necessary activities that contribute to the success of the Project.
